<title>net: stmmac: overwrite the dma_cap.addr64 according to HW design</title>
<updated>2020-12-08T22:52:29+00:00</updated>
<author>
<name>Fugang Duan</name>
<email>fugang.duan@nxp.com</email>
</author>
<published>2020-12-07T10:51:41+00:00</published>
<link rel='alternate' type='text/html' href='https://git.toradex.cn/cgit/linux-toradex.git/commit/?id=f119cc9818eb33b66e977ad3af75aef6500bbdc3'/>
<id>f119cc9818eb33b66e977ad3af75aef6500bbdc3</id>
<content type='text'>
The current IP register MAC_HW_Feature1[ADDR64] only defines
32/40/64 bit width, but some SOCs support others like i.MX8MP
support 34 bits but it maps to 40 bits width in MAC_HW_Feature1[ADDR64].
So overwrite dma_cap.addr64 according to HW real design.

<title>net: stmmac: Add option for VLAN filter fail queue enable</title>
<updated>2020-09-25T23:48:33+00:00</updated>
<author>
<name>Chuah, Kim Tatt</name>
<email>kim.tatt.chuah@intel.com</email>
</author>
<published>2020-09-25T09:40:41+00:00</published>
<link rel='alternate' type='text/html' href='https://git.toradex.cn/cgit/linux-toradex.git/commit/?id=e0f9956a3862b32ad73869a8e52a33c84aafa46f'/>
<id>e0f9956a3862b32ad73869a8e52a33c84aafa46f</id>
<content type='text'>
Add option in plat_stmmacenet_data struct to enable VLAN Filter Fail
Queuing. This option allows packets that fail VLAN filter to be routed
to a specific Rx queue when Receive All is also set.

When this option is enabled:
- Enable VFFQ only when entering promiscuous mode, because Receive All
  will pass up all rx packets that failed address filtering (similar to
  promiscuous mode).
- VLAN-promiscuous mode is never entered to allow rx packet to fail VLAN
  filters and get routed to selected VFFQ Rx queue.

<title>net: stmmac: Enable SERDES power up/down sequence</title>
<updated>2020-04-21T22:54:45+00:00</updated>
<author>
<name>Voon Weifeng</name>
<email>weifeng.voon@intel.com</email>
</author>
<published>2020-04-20T15:42:52+00:00</published>
<link rel='alternate' type='text/html' href='https://git.toradex.cn/cgit/linux-toradex.git/commit/?id=b9663b7ca6ff780555108394c9c1b409f63b99a7'/>
<id>b9663b7ca6ff780555108394c9c1b409f63b99a7</id>
<content type='text'>
This patch is to enable Intel SERDES power up/down sequence. The SERDES
converts 8/10 bits data to SGMII signal. Below is an example of
HW configuration for SGMII mode. The SERDES is located in the PHY IF
in the diagram below.

&lt;-----------------GBE Controller----------&gt;|&lt;--External PHY chip--&gt;
+----------+         +----+            +---+           +----------+
|   EQoS   | &lt;-GMII-&gt;| DW | &lt; ------ &gt; |PHY| &lt;-SGMII-&gt; | External |
|   MAC    |         |xPCS|            |IF |           | PHY      |
+----------+         +----+            +---+           +----------+
       ^               ^                 ^                ^
       |               |                 |                |
       +---------------------MDIO-------------------------+

PHY IF configuration and status registers are accessible through
mdio address 0x15 which is defined as mdio_adhoc_addr. During D0,
The driver will need to power up PHY IF by changing the power state
to P0. Likewise, for D3, the driver sets PHY IF power state to P3.

<title>net: of_get_phy_mode: Change API to solve int/unit warnings</title>
<updated>2019-11-04T19:21:25+00:00</updated>
<author>
<name>Andrew Lunn</name>
<email>andrew@lunn.ch</email>
</author>
<published>2019-11-04T01:40:33+00:00</published>
<link rel='alternate' type='text/html' href='https://git.toradex.cn/cgit/linux-toradex.git/commit/?id=0c65b2b90d13c1deaee6449304dd367c5d4eb8ae'/>
<id>0c65b2b90d13c1deaee6449304dd367c5d4eb8ae</id>
<content type='text'>
Before this change of_get_phy_mode() returned an enum,
phy_interface_t. On error, -ENODEV etc, is returned. If the result of
the function is stored in a variable of type phy_interface_t, and the
compiler has decided to represent this as an unsigned int, comparision
with -ENODEV etc, is a signed vs unsigned comparision.

Fix this problem by changing the API. Make the function return an
error, or 0 on success, and pass a pointer, of type phy_interface_t,
where the phy mode should be stored.
